Nuzleaf is a Uncommon from the Pokémon TCG set Legend Maker (EX series), card #41 of 93. It's one of 26 Uncommon cards in the set.

It's a Stage1 Darkness Pokémon with 70 HP, weak to Fighting ×2, resistant to Psychic -30, and retreats for 1 energy. Its attacks are Pound (20) and Plunder (30). It evolves from Seedot. The art is by Katsura Tabata.

Attacks

Pound

20

Plunder

30

Before doing damage, discard all Trainer cards attached to the Defending Pokémon.
